Question 1: What is the primary function of an air conditioning compressor?
A: To compress the refrigerant
B: To filter the air
C: To cool the indoor space
D: To dehumidify the air
Answer: A
Explanation: The compressor compresses the refrigerant, increasing its pressure and temperature so it
can release heat in the condenser.
Question 2: Which component in an AC system is primarily responsible for releasing heat?
A: Evaporator coil
B: Condenser coil
C: Expansion valve
D: Compressor
Answer: B
Explanation: The condenser coil releases the heat absorbed from indoors by the refrigerant after it is
compressed.
Question 3: What role does the evaporator coil play in an air conditioning system?
A: It compresses the refrigerant
B: It absorbs heat from indoor air
C: It releases heat outside
D: It controls refrigerant flow
Answer: B
Explanation: The evaporator coil absorbs heat from indoor air, causing the refrigerant to evaporate and
cool the space.

Question 5: What is the purpose of an expansion valve in an AC system?
A: To compress refrigerant
B: To regulate refrigerant flow
C: To circulate air
D: To filter contaminants
Answer: B
,Explanation: The expansion valve controls the refrigerant flow and pressure, ensuring the correct
amount reaches the evaporator coil.

Question 7: Which of the following is a common safety measure when working on an AC system?
A: Keeping the power on
B: Ignoring protective gear
C: Using lockout/tagout procedures
D: Using any available tool regardless of condition
Answer: C
Explanation: Lockout/tagout procedures are used to ensure that the system is de-energized during
maintenance, protecting technicians from electrical hazards.
Question 8: What type of air conditioning system is typically installed in a residential setting and
consists of an outdoor unit and one or more indoor units?
A: Central air conditioning
B: Split system
C: Window unit
D: Packaged system
Answer: B
Explanation: A split system has both an outdoor compressor/condenser and an indoor evaporator unit,
making it common in residences.
